Product Description:

The most difficult thing about learning a language is certainly to find time for it, isn't it? With the ProVoc widget, you can now use any spare minute to quickly train a couple of words... The ideal short break to take at any time!


Includes several intelligent training modes:

  • Written test
  • Multiple choice questions
  • Slideshow of vocabulary

Customizable at will:

  • Train any vocabulary file on your computer
  • Any test direction
  • Custom text size and background
  • etc.
